Donar $20 Donar $50 Donar $100 Donar mensualmente
 


Enviar respuesta 
 
Calificación:
  • 0 votos - 0 Media
  • 1
  • 2
  • 3
  • 4
  • 5
Buscar en el tema
Segundo Parcial Resuelto 2016 - Equipos de Futbol - Pablo Sznajdleder
Autor Mensaje
ferdaniel Sin conexión
Empleado del buffet
阴阳
*

Ing. en Sistemas
Facultad Regional Buenos Aires

Mensajes: 23
Agradecimientos dados: 0
Agradecimientos: 43 en 11 posts
Registro en: Sep 2015
Mensaje: #1
Segundo Parcial Resuelto 2016 - Equipos de Futbol - Pablo Sznajdleder Parciales y 2 más Algoritmos y Estructuras de Datos
PROBLEMA TIPO PARCIAL
Se tienen los siguientes archivos de registros, cuyas estructuras se detallan a continuación.
RESULTADOS.dat
EQUIPOS.DAT
ESTADIOS.DAT

struct Resultado
{
int idEq1;
int idEq2;
int resulado;
int idEst;
}

struct Equipo
{
int idEq;
string nombre;
int puntos;
}

struct Estadio
{
int idEst;
string nombre;
}
Notas:
a. Si resultado<0 => idEq1 ganó. Si resultado>0 => idEq2 ganó. Si resultado==0 => empate.
b. El equipo ganador acumula 3 puntos. Si empataron acumulan 1 punto cada uno. El perdedor no acumula puntos.
c. Se sabe que, a lo sumo, compitieron 50 equipos que jugaron los partidos en los no más de 20 estadios
Se pide:
1 – Informar la tabla de posiciones. (listado de todos los equipos, ordenado decrecientemente por los puntos acumulados).
2 – Para los 3 equipos con mayor cantidad de puntos, indicar todos los estadios en los que jugaron y ganaron sus partidos.
3 – Actualizar los puntos acumulados de cada equipo.
TADs:
struct Equipos
{
Equipo a[50];
int len;
}
struct Estadios
{
Estadio a[20];
int len;
}


Formato : PDF
Adicional: Solo estan resueltas las funciones principales

Parcial Resuelto(Diagrama)
30-11-2016 16:20
Envíale un email Encuentra todos sus mensajes Agregar agradecimiento Cita este mensaje en tu respuesta
[-] ferdaniel recibio 1 Gracias por este post
missmetal (02-12-2016)
Buscar en el tema
Enviar respuesta 




Usuario(s) navegando en este tema: 1 invitado(s)



    This forum uses Lukasz Tkacz MyBB addons.